How should firearms be transported in a boat?

The firearm should be transported unloaded and protected with a case. The unloaded position should be done for ensuring the safety of the firearm's carrier in the boat so that no blind shot could occur during the transporting process. The case is used for protecting the firearm from water in case of water leakage.
